Design Constraint
Residential interiors are demanding acoustic environments. Reflective surfaces, open plans and shifting circulation patterns conflict with the stillness required for a precise sonic image. Our brief across these projects has been to deliver acoustic performance that respects the material palette, the rhythm of daily use and the discipline of the wider design scheme.
Sonic Concept
Across each home we work as a single audio design partner from concept through to commissioning. Zonal architecture, passive loudspeaker specification, DSP driven calibration and intuitive control are coordinated against the architectural drawing set. Loudspeakers are positioned as intentional design elements, never afterthoughts, and never visually compromised by late stage technical compromise.
Integration Approach
Cabling routes, speaker positions, subwoofer locations and control points are planned alongside the joinery, the lighting design and the finishes. The system is engineered for spatial continuity, so the listening experience is consistent as the resident moves between rooms, and tuned for low level intelligibility as well as full range performance during entertaining.
